Hi guys , i'm trying to understand cpu / vpcus terms and relations.
Looking at my cpu specs (Intel® Xeon® E5-2650 v2)
It says:
Cores: 8
subprocess 16


when creating vm , it does not allow me to set more than 4 sockets
If a set 4 socket x 33Cores = 132
then I can not turn of the vm with following message:
TASK ERROR: MAX 32 vcpus allowed per VM on this node
So max processor hardware I can assign is 4 sockets x 8 CORES = 32.
So ...
Why max socket is 4 ?
Why max count socket x cores = 32 ?
What is the difference between vpcus , cores and sockets.
which of them (sockets , vpus and cores) are virtual / physical ?

The only relation I can understand is with 8 cores mentioned on datasheet
and 8
cores listed when assigning processor hardware.
BTW:
My other pve node has a X5680 with 6 cores, and it allows max 24vcpus.
